Welcome to

San Lucas Tolimán

A quieter Atitlán town with local life and lake access.

San Lucas Tolimán sits on the southeastern shore of Lake Atitlán and feels more local than the main backpacker hubs. Travelers come for a lower-key lakeside stay, community tourism, and a different angle on the volcano-ringed lake.

Fast facts

  • Less touristy than Panajachel or San Pedro, with a stronger local rhythm.
  • Lakeside setting with views toward Atitlán’s volcanoes.
  • Useful alternative base if you want quieter nights and community-focused stays.
  • Transport connections may be less frequent—plan boat and shuttle timing carefully.
